Abstract

 This work presents a mathematical framework for the analysis and control of coupled partial differential equations governing transport phenomena in porous vanadium redox flow battery electrodes. The model integrates Brinkman–Forchheimer equations for momentum transport, convection–diffusion–reaction equations for species distribution, and Butler–Volmer kinetics for electrochemical dynamics, forming a strongly coupled nonlinear PDE system with spatially heterogeneous coefficients. Well-posedness of the forward problem is established, and adjoint-based sensitivity analysis is developed for parameter dependence. The core innovation lies in formulating electrode design as an optimal control problem, where the spatially distributed permeability field  serves as the control variable optimized under manufacturing and pressure drop constraints. Using the Method of Moving Asymptotes within a topology optimization framework, biomimetic permeability architectures inspired by vascular networks are synthesized.
